## Abstract The ^13^C NMR signals of the two methyl groups in 4‐hydroxy‐1‐isopropyl‐2‐oxaadamantane are anisochronous in the presence of Yb(fod)~3~. This is interpreted in terms of the different populations of three rotational conformers.
